The journey from Edappal to Nilambur covers 75 kilometers, taking you deeper into the lush green landscapes of the Malappuram district. The trip takes approximately 2 hours via the SH 39 and local roads. Nilambur is famous for its teak forests, the world's first teak museum, and its proximity to the Western Ghats. Buses are the primary mode of transport, offering a scenic ride through the countryside. This route is popular among nature enthusiasts and those visiting the forest regions.
Total Distance: 75 km driving distance; 65 km straight-line air distance.
Direct buses are limited; you may need to change at Perinthalmanna.
